A new lawsuit filed against Ramsey Solutions accuses the company of retaliating and discriminating against an employee who questioned owner Dave Ramsey s handling of coronavirus precautions.
The suit, first reported by Religion News Service, was filed by attorneys representing Brad Amos, a former employee who said he was fired after he questioned Ramsey s downplaying of the coronavirus pandemic and cult-like atmosphere.
After a grueling 60-day process of more than a dozen interviews, including ones with his wife, a personality test and disclosure of his monthly budget, Amos relocated from Los Angeles to Williamson County for a video editor role with Ramsey Solutions in August 2019.

Christian finance virtuoso Dave Ramsey is unloading a 13,545-square-foot home in a gated Nashville suburb for $15.45 million.
The six-bedroom, nine-bathroom home, listed last week, sits on more than 14 acres at the top of a hill, allowing for sunset views over the surrounding foothills, according to listing agent Kelly Gammer of Nashville’s Capital Realty Group.
“The house boasts the best views in Williamson County with stunning sunsets,” she said in an email.

Even as Americans are being infected, hospitalized and killed by COVID-19 in record numbers, the scene Saturday night outside the headquarters of Christian financial personality Dave Ramsey’s Ramsey Solutions looked like a festival designed to flout public health guidelines. The talk-radio host who preaches debt-free living and business success threw a maskless indoor company Christmas party at the company’s Franklin, Tenn., headquarters with more than 1,500 people invited to attend.
